Important Announcement!
The NHS Talking Therapies service for Southampton City has left Dorset HealthCare and joined the Hampshire & Isle of Wight Healthcare NHS Foundation Trust, as of April 1st 2026.
Why?
Joining other Hampshire based NHS services under one Trust creates a more integrated approach across the regions mental health system. It also strengthens links with local community organisations, and other public bodies such as the City Council, for example.
What Does It Mean For Patients?
If you were registered with the Southampton service whilst it was with Dorset HealthCare, whether you were on a waiting list or already receiving therapy, you will not see a change, except perhaps in the headings of any paperwork you receive – your treatment and therapist will remain exactly the same.
If you’re thinking of self-referring to the Southampton service, please don’t hesitate! They will be happy to hear from you, however, please check the conditions below carefully.
You should be 16 years of age or more when referring.
From 1st April, Steps2Wellbeing will no longer accept patients in the Southampton City area. Instead, please self-refer to NHS Talking Therapies Hampshire, via https://www.talkingtherapieshiow.nhs.uk/
Registered with a GP in Southampton City.
Telephone numbers remain the same – after 1st April you can still self-refer by telephone, too; just dial 0800 612 7000, or 02380 272000 and speak to a member of the Southampton team.
